技术文摘
HTML、CSS 与 jQuery 实现图片切换高级功能的方法
HTML、CSS 与 jQuery 实现图片切换高级功能的方法
在网页设计中,图片切换效果可以大大提升用户体验,为页面增添生动和交互性。本文将介绍如何利用HTML、CSS与jQuery实现图片切换的高级功能。
HTML是构建网页结构的基础。我们需要创建一个包含图片的容器,例如使用<div>标签。在这个容器中,通过<img>标签插入要切换的图片。为了方便操作,给每个图片设置唯一的id或class属性。
接下来,CSS用于对图片和容器进行样式设置。可以设置容器的尺寸、位置、背景颜色等,使图片在页面中呈现出合适的布局。对于图片本身,可以设置其大小、边框、阴影等效果,增强视觉吸引力。
而要实现高级的图片切换功能,jQuery则发挥着关键作用。它是一个强大的JavaScript库,能够简化DOM操作和事件处理。
一种常见的图片切换效果是淡入淡出。通过jQuery的fadeIn()和fadeOut()方法,可以轻松实现这种效果。当用户触发某个事件,如点击按钮时,当前显示的图片逐渐淡出,然后下一张图片逐渐淡入。
另一种高级功能是自动循环切换图片。可以使用setInterval()函数设置一个时间间隔,让图片按照一定的顺序自动切换。为了提供更好的用户体验,还可以添加暂停和继续切换的功能,当用户将鼠标悬停在图片上时暂停切换,移开鼠标后继续。
还可以实现带有过渡动画的图片切换效果,如滑动、缩放等。这需要结合CSS的过渡属性和jQuery的动画方法来实现。
在实际应用中,还需要考虑到浏览器的兼容性。确保在不同的浏览器中都能正常显示和切换图片。
通过HTML构建网页结构,CSS设置样式,再结合jQuery的强大功能,就能够实现各种高级的图片切换效果。开发者可以根据项目需求,灵活运用这些技术,为用户带来更加精彩的网页体验。
- Vue应用中使用axios出现TypeError bind is not a function的解决办法
- Vue 利用插件达成组件复用的技巧
- Vue 实现拖拽元素复制与移动的方法
- Vue 实现在线聊天功能的方法
- Vue UI 常用组件使用技巧
- Vue 路由控制与管理技巧
- Vue 实现可折叠列表的方法
- Vue 利用 mixin 实现列表、表格、表单等组件复用的技巧
- Vue 实现日期范围选择器的方法
- Vue CLI创建项目时遇到Unexpected end of JSON input的解决办法
- Vue 实现图片懒加载的最优方法
- Vue 实现可拖拽布局的方法
- Vue应用使用vue-resource出现Error: "xxx" is not defined的解决方法
- Vue 实现小程序样式页面设计的方法
- Vue 实现分组列表的方法